记得上下班打卡 | git大法好,push需谨慎

Commit 48d67b7c authored by 姜秀龙's avatar 姜秀龙

Merge remote-tracking branch 'origin/dev-1.6-shouqianba' into dev-1.6-shouqianba

# Conflicts:
#	liquidnet-bus-api/liquidnet-service-goblin-api/src/main/java/com/liquidnet/service/goblin/param/shouqianba/response/data/AcquiringCreateData.java
#	liquidnet-bus-api/liquidnet-service-goblin-api/src/main/java/com/liquidnet/service/goblin/param/shouqianba/response/data/CashierQueryData.java
#	liquidnet-bus-api/liquidnet-service-goblin-api/src/main/java/com/liquidnet/service/goblin/param/shouqianba/response/data/CouponRefundData.java
#	liquidnet-bus-api/liquidnet-service-goblin-api/src/main/java/com/liquidnet/service/goblin/param/shouqianba/response/data/CreateWechatPrepayOrderData.java
#	liquidnet-bus-api/liquidnet-service-goblin-api/src/main/java/com/liquidnet/service/goblin/param/shouqianba/response/data/OrderCreateData.java
#	liquidnet-bus-api/liquidnet-service-goblin-api/src/main/java/com/liquidnet/service/goblin/param/shouqianba/response/data/SettlementCreateData.java
parents 873044cd 91a997e2
package com.liquidnet.service.goblin.param.shouqianba.request;
import com.fasterxml.jackson.annotation.JsonIgnoreProperties;
import io.swagger.annotations.ApiModel;
import io.swagger.annotations.ApiModelProperty;
import lombok.Data;
......@@ -9,6 +10,7 @@ public class CommonRequest {
@Data
@ApiModel(value = "商城信息")
@JsonIgnoreProperties(ignoreUnknown = true)
public static class Mall{
@ApiModelProperty(required = true, value = "商城ID")
......@@ -20,6 +22,7 @@ public class CommonRequest {
@Data
@ApiModel(value = "卖家信息/商户信息")
@JsonIgnoreProperties(ignoreUnknown = true)
public static class Seller {
@ApiModelProperty(required = true, value = "商户ID")
private String merchantId;
......@@ -33,6 +36,7 @@ public class CommonRequest {
@Data
@ApiModel("买家信息")
@JsonIgnoreProperties(ignoreUnknown = true)
public static class Buyer{
@ApiModelProperty(required = true, value = "买家ID(用户唯一标识)")
private String buyerId;
......@@ -40,6 +44,7 @@ public class CommonRequest {
@Data
@ApiModel("付款人信息")
@JsonIgnoreProperties(ignoreUnknown = true)
public static class Payer{
@ApiModelProperty(required = true, value = "付款人ID")
private String userId;
......@@ -47,6 +52,7 @@ public class CommonRequest {
@ApiModel(value = "收单信息")
@Data
@JsonIgnoreProperties(ignoreUnknown = true)
public static class Acquiring{
@ApiModelProperty(value = "收单号")
private String acquiringSn;
......
package com.liquidnet.service.goblin.param.shouqianba.response.data;
import com.liquidnet.service.goblin.param.shouqianba.request.CommonRequest;
import com.fasterxml.jackson.annotation.JsonIgnoreProperties;
import com.liquidnet.service.goblin.param.shouqianba.request.CommonRequest;
import io.swagger.annotations.ApiModel;
import lombok.Data;
import lombok.EqualsAndHashCode;
@EqualsAndHashCode(callSuper = true)
@Data
@ApiModel(value = "创建收单Data")
@JsonIgnoreProperties(ignoreUnknown = true)
@ApiModel(value = "创建收单查询结果数据")
public class AcquiringCreateData extends CommonRequest.Acquiring {
}
......@@ -8,8 +8,8 @@ import lombok.Data;
import java.util.List;
@Data
@ApiModel(value = "收银台查询Data")
@JsonIgnoreProperties(ignoreUnknown = true)
@ApiModel(value = "自助收银查询响应数据")
public class CashierQueryData {
@ApiModelProperty(value = "支付工具列表")
......@@ -38,6 +38,7 @@ public class CashierQueryData {
@Data
@ApiModel(value = "支付工具详情")
@JsonIgnoreProperties(ignoreUnknown = true)
public static class PayTool {
@ApiModelProperty(value = "支付工具id")
private Long id;
......@@ -69,6 +70,7 @@ public class CashierQueryData {
@Data
@ApiModel(value = "金额构成信息")
@JsonIgnoreProperties(ignoreUnknown = true)
public static class AmountComposition {
@ApiModelProperty(required = true, value = "金额构成项列表")
private List<CompositionItem> compositionItems;
......@@ -76,6 +78,7 @@ public class CashierQueryData {
@Data
@ApiModel(value = "金额构成项详情")
@JsonIgnoreProperties(ignoreUnknown = true)
public static class CompositionItem {
@ApiModelProperty(required = true, value = "构成项类目")
private String category;
......@@ -86,6 +89,7 @@ public class CashierQueryData {
@Data
@ApiModel(value = "收款方信息")
@JsonIgnoreProperties(ignoreUnknown = true)
public static class Payee {
@ApiModelProperty(value = "商户id")
private String merchantId;
......@@ -105,6 +109,7 @@ public class CashierQueryData {
@Data
@ApiModel(value = "业务信息")
@JsonIgnoreProperties(ignoreUnknown = true)
public static class BizInfo {
@ApiModelProperty(value = "业务方")
private String bizParty;
......@@ -115,6 +120,7 @@ public class CashierQueryData {
@Data
@ApiModel(value = "金额明细模型")
@JsonIgnoreProperties(ignoreUnknown = true)
public static class CashierAmount {
@ApiModelProperty(value = "原始支付金额")
private Long oriPaymentAmount;
......
......@@ -9,6 +9,7 @@ import lombok.Data;
@Data
@JsonIgnoreProperties(ignoreUnknown = true)
@ApiModel(value = "查询券码响应Data")
@JsonIgnoreProperties(ignoreUnknown = true)
public class CouponQueryData {
@ApiModelProperty(value = "券名称")
......
......@@ -6,8 +6,8 @@ import io.swagger.annotations.ApiModelProperty;
import lombok.Data;
@Data
@ApiModel(value = "券退款响应结果")
@JsonIgnoreProperties(ignoreUnknown = true)
@ApiModel(value = "券退款Data")
public class CouponRefundData {
@ApiModelProperty(value = "退款单号")
......
......@@ -6,8 +6,8 @@ import io.swagger.annotations.ApiModelProperty;
import lombok.Data;
@Data
@ApiModel(value = "创建微信预支付订单响应")
@JsonIgnoreProperties(ignoreUnknown = true)
@ApiModel(value = "创建微信预支付订单响应数据内容")
public class CreateWechatPrepayOrderData {
@ApiModelProperty(value = "收单号")
......@@ -30,6 +30,7 @@ public class CreateWechatPrepayOrderData {
@Data
@ApiModel(value = "订单金额明细")
@JsonIgnoreProperties(ignoreUnknown = true)
public static class AmountDetails {
@ApiModelProperty(value = "收单总金额")
......@@ -44,6 +45,7 @@ public class CreateWechatPrepayOrderData {
@Data
@ApiModel(value = "支付凭证详情")
@JsonIgnoreProperties(ignoreUnknown = true)
public static class PaymentVoucher {
@ApiModelProperty(value = "时间戳")
......@@ -67,6 +69,7 @@ public class CreateWechatPrepayOrderData {
@Data
@ApiModel(value = "通道信息详情")
@JsonIgnoreProperties(ignoreUnknown = true)
public static class ChannelInfo {
@ApiModelProperty(value = "收钱吧通道流水号")
......
......@@ -10,6 +10,7 @@ import java.util.List;
@Data
@JsonIgnoreProperties(ignoreUnknown = true)
@ApiModel(value = "商城列表查询响应数据")
@JsonIgnoreProperties(ignoreUnknown = true)
public class MallListQueryData {
@ApiModelProperty("商城编号")
......@@ -46,7 +47,7 @@ public class MallListQueryData {
private String crossCityPaymentStatusDesc;
@ApiModelProperty("应用类型 0拼塔商城 目前都是0,无需关注")
private String appType;
private Integer appType;
@ApiModelProperty("行业code")
private String industryCode;
......@@ -70,6 +71,7 @@ public class MallListQueryData {
@Data
@JsonIgnoreProperties(ignoreUnknown = true)
@ApiModel("商户信息")
@JsonIgnoreProperties(ignoreUnknown = true)
public static class Seller {
@ApiModelProperty("商户号")
private String merchantSn;
......@@ -99,6 +101,7 @@ public class MallListQueryData {
@Data
@JsonIgnoreProperties(ignoreUnknown = true)
@ApiModel("订单统计")
@JsonIgnoreProperties(ignoreUnknown = true)
public static class OrderStatistics {
@ApiModelProperty("订单数量")
private Long totalNum;
......@@ -113,6 +116,7 @@ public class MallListQueryData {
@Data
@JsonIgnoreProperties(ignoreUnknown = true)
@ApiModel("商户统计")
@JsonIgnoreProperties(ignoreUnknown = true)
public static class SellerStatisticsModel {
@ApiModelProperty("异地交易失败订单数量")
private Long orderFailNum;
......@@ -121,6 +125,7 @@ public class MallListQueryData {
@Data
@JsonIgnoreProperties(ignoreUnknown = true)
@ApiModel("跨城支付明细")
@JsonIgnoreProperties(ignoreUnknown = true)
public static class CrossCityPayment {
@ApiModelProperty("支付工具code 2:支付宝 3:微信")
private Byte payToolCode;
......@@ -129,7 +134,7 @@ public class MallListQueryData {
private String payToolCodeDesc;
@ApiModelProperty("大额开通状态")
private String status;
private Integer status;
@ApiModelProperty("大额开通状态描述")
private String statusDesc;
......
......@@ -11,6 +11,7 @@ import java.util.List;
@Data
@JsonIgnoreProperties(ignoreUnknown = true)
@ApiModel(value = "商城商品接口响应数据")
@JsonIgnoreProperties(ignoreUnknown = true)
public class MallProductsQueryData {
@ApiModelProperty(value = "商品spuId")
......@@ -32,6 +33,7 @@ public class MallProductsQueryData {
@Data
@JsonIgnoreProperties(ignoreUnknown = true)
@ApiModel(value = "商品规格")
@JsonIgnoreProperties(ignoreUnknown = true)
public static class Sku {
@ApiModelProperty(value = "库存类型")
......
package com.liquidnet.service.goblin.param.shouqianba.response.data;
import com.liquidnet.service.goblin.param.shouqianba.request.CommonRequest;
import com.fasterxml.jackson.annotation.JsonIgnoreProperties;
import com.liquidnet.service.goblin.param.shouqianba.request.CommonRequest;
import io.swagger.annotations.ApiModel;
import io.swagger.annotations.ApiModelProperty;
import lombok.Data;
import org.springframework.security.core.parameters.P;
@Data
@ApiModel(value = "收钱吧创建订单响应参数Data")
@JsonIgnoreProperties(ignoreUnknown = true)
@ApiModel(value = "创建订单Data")
public class OrderCreateData {
@ApiModelProperty(value = "订单编号)")
......
......@@ -6,8 +6,8 @@ import io.swagger.annotations.ApiModelProperty;
import lombok.Data;
@Data
@ApiModel(value = "收钱吧创建结算明细响应参数Data")
@JsonIgnoreProperties(ignoreUnknown = true)
@ApiModel(value = "创建结算Data")
public class SettlementCreateData {
@ApiModelProperty(value = "结算项ID)")
......
......@@ -26,3 +26,12 @@ liquidnet:
public-key: "MI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IBCgKCAQEArR8pqWsRMqiunn8uEZGF9AeizJK0vuWjlcNnTbw9Sb96dMVuYu3SRj+Dx4E4SgyEL4CYROou1xwY57kAKEqHdH7o1W41O9jYjXZG38BrtBR+D9Qh9OqGxCZ+e4Gi38XHGg6fn67iXefOqp1kWGd4qc8tIZO1lIDXS19R09D/mESNBMulQdVPyZF7gvd11A+7EEOfRlSOjrtqIoUWV0GIqhLPUtGJk8Uq/d9NLitJyvK3tgz8cvJ4RyK6UpGtRDrqiBiQxbvK9EqMd1sw3zkvM03szSWon4LHFNqvDr6RYfFyFUCvX9UPYmeritENnroEuTBlTFLLb68ed4HZEZDPTQIDAQAB"
private-key: "MIIEwAIBADANBgkqhkiG9w0BAQEFAASCBKowggSmAgEAAoIBAQDJAOaA1ikJzDL0vUuTyl3/vlHyuSod6/gFLLrSTD6EJkma5Ld34HHu82/5pEojEvbcU113L9j3fUJlpyjX6CFk6j2KjMIuyFxhgrVFi5WT5m74wYohoWNifkQrgwsO3oxI7cewWFu/w7/yCK9dzI4QxasGUKH9iPweI+26IR0DBbOfC9GVudOy2b2xLrGAevEEHdVTNqrQNdlrTzqAH7r3uk8s2vaBZX+O4gyf7eKdHdC4CVSWfYPLO1sA48MxNwI7OExxfGeV+0wmBMGRSoZ5FhWsqZs+f9jGcmfF+uEfAO71PqHjezXYxq7+oWDfDBPCTc5fo9w5v1HV0aZaYOe1AgMBAAECggEBAI4yR98fInse7XF8NOpBwIv6/QhEfAoc9CHdCfFaJOPiHjIo2a5BpvhPWYj288eqU998TmPSAqDbCUzWm6taOb2lhJHukDT+Y3RMPqcLX275Fsp+SJUQEjoMb3eExh7ny8CQDrOvXoDkH3c/M6ic3Gf7Hslh46dz8D/2VOhXIqoObPlSLzniwiMTDBEwB7IRc3Q+r4V6ZnKt8wjKQZpotBA3TlJlEBBj/h5SbWokwMQbTqFkjl7gVe0ase2WfV+cD4qhPZx6CWphPVyWelg+wpDqXOIQdnE8pgri5a9ZkzgPTOrKyCm+EOa9lZAp81tnb2iFhrlkKPSWUW8zLtZzxMECgYEA+sNyF0U9anyxeKxXtlGKKuMHJSnBpZeU6FSvZjTewFH2Sxh3QwZjg6h5BfvTLH1XfNerx3gdpAPJ+EyAZuEibDr47bp+j4CtT27dVolz5XQ5ugOadwzdNZkq6vhuq1aGATmS/mlNE1/pdMEP9F6hi2HYncER6BFOy0xSwMKCnRECgYEAzTNxhvZ0pb2hPKylxHUydkm3Uznq5Zkquv6II6W5aiKvceETHwdRZLoKc+I0kd0/4fBfJI2Jsjexy51ERiG+8y4wVrcrky6NLw6mnXSvnTSQCftbexheJTg9c5dpfKIj+rxtuBeZ3Sj1MJQ6OSBUYu3iTqstO0Rgp/1ofWQJ8GUCgYEAspxzr0+KJ0cZwbI/54S8vT9n33iWjbQiRDnNlScjYij/HQ4YJI1wZF6jlTeBerbskeesWy+bLS/ltA4Jhz3knuKCXBHyA5TL3UBCN1lAS7c1RuE6LIHlLkAi6ap6aV//ou+3W671T0+JobfB/XVJ61WOTQ8wCfQKA5QhfVsOXYECgYEAvzbm3Ysfm6qfazi+p9lGErASov1fhGA8T1AMcJtnsh1sO8Qu20UodaJfRylNL3dqphIltpwl6eq4RTLhgjDEDTvHU6cQdfB1I5qVbDhlxSpL5uFRl91XLXvA18wKQledC3M3Esr7V/loscIOl1knCaD+t6wPVCEdqK0dB2uHT3kCgYEA3p3rlmCmWzkZ/U8jE4087YEkJWV+r86YC63r4YZEqZtfHk4hNchAYke4jYPqkTtmRVZi2C6KuVr5M3ASHmGWorBY0VA9Abd3daniNocZCeMOt4Z7U6MIbqW7KYSrjx8V8HIsdH7HF97ofRuMH6oaz9bFMM6XwrEAMY+zTdH9A4Y="
notify-url: 'https://testgoblin.zhengzai.tv/goblin/bracelet/callback'
shouqianba:
base-api: 'https://open-apisix.iwosai.com'
app-id: '2025082700005615'
app-key: '4d5c7647853bba34a0b5af42bc2400e7'
app-code: 'DWTY'
public-key: 'MI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IBCgKCAQEA3Hlg887xrRWYxPqLDX53oimjsxfd7PDdhQ4zHUYA1eQP6PMyhAo+GU/oq4RQVpW6LrG0PWA6CoD7qva6T0NwsDWn5/fmWhmH+Ad6K5WG5jY9ZVjnys9R+HGeFyE7hSkhqSgiSlEMv9IBJD5p9ZqBZ0FAPotMS/RIBHANVA37J0Zlp9wakvUegcXb3hl9xp+aRsjikhS5h89qiPPXGkWq9dsQrbpDODP8RziqskxzIzu4tYtvLkUZ/Ak9LCRu63SSGX+yAj24mG9Q+4taWGX32AmuVFK9CGDoec0IYx8ouUtiGWVBqZz0dRteKbBbL6MtnPjUxT+wMc6rarPL8zj9vwIDAQAB'
merchant-id: 'fd567f94-9a44-4ae5-879f-9acc919d0f89'
merchant-user-id: '42c556cc-1509-4de0-bfc3-dfbcb48eae57'
role: 'super_admin'
\ No newline at end of file
......@@ -31,8 +31,8 @@ public class GoblinShouQianBaServiceImplTest {
CommonRequest.Seller seller = new CommonRequest.Seller();
seller.setRole("super_admin");
seller.setMerchantId("1c904b2df056-4afa-a819-0328a4774320");
seller.setMerchantUserId("6ce169d1-1289-4e98-b4a3-ea8b6145046f");
seller.setMerchantId("fd567f94-9a44-4ae5-879f-9acc919d0f89");
seller.setMerchantUserId("42c556cc-1509-4de0-bfc3-dfbcb48eae57");
MallListQueryRequest.Filter filter = new MallListQueryRequest.Filter();
filter.setSeller(seller);
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ment